The ADA token has several key functions. It is used to pay transaction fees on the Cardano network, similar to gas on other blockchains. ADA holders can also participate in the network's governance by voting on proposals. Furthermore, ADA can be staked to help secure the network and earn rewards through its Ouroboros consensus mechanism.
Ouroboros is a provably secure Proof-of-Stake (PoS) protocol based on peer-reviewed research. It divides time into 'epochs,' which are further split into 'slots.' For each slot, a slot leader is randomly chosen from the pool of ADA stakers to create the next block. This method is highly energy-efficient and decentralized compared to Proof-of-Work mining.
Yes, once you have acquired Cardano (ADA), you can stake it to earn rewards. This involves delegating your ADA to a stake pool from a compatible wallet (like Daedalus or Yoroi). Staking contributes to the network's security and decentralization, and you will receive ADA rewards at the end of each epoch (approximately every 5 days).
The Extended Unspent Transaction Output (EUTXO) model is an evolution of Bitcoin's UTXO model. It allows for more predictable transaction costs and avoids the concurrency issues seen in account-based models like Ethereum's. This makes smart contract interactions on Cardano more deterministic and secure, as the outcome of a transaction is known before it is submitted on-chain.
Switzerland has a well-defined regulatory framework for digital assets, overseen by FINMA. When you exchange CHF for Cardano (ADA) on a Swiss-regulated platform, you must comply with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and Know Your Customer (KYC) requirements. Capital gains from private crypto investments are generally tax-exempt for individuals, but it's crucial to consult a tax advisor for personalized guidance.
